            Implemented a new "auto-sync" option for estimates, please see details here on what it does and does not sync: https://confluence.atlassian.com/display/JIRAPortfolioServer/Synchronization+Settings

            Generally, this is and potentially remains a tricky topic as long as the Portfolio schedule is not "live" but from a given start date. If we'd just sync back the remaining effort any time it changes, we'd gradually reduce the scope while still looking at the same plan start date, thus this remains part of the Plan > Update from date functionality. however, editing the story point estimate, or in case of time the original estimate, can now be synced back instantly if the option is turned on.

            I believe this is must-have functionality, but it should be implemented along with an option to turn it on/off, since it allows individual developers updating the estimate on their issue to change the roadmap/schedule displayed in Portfolio. Some teams will want that, some won't. The toggle for this could perhaps be combined with the 'dynamic/fixed' schedule option which already exists, since that's basically what this boils down to.
